The planetary 3-hour-range index Kp is the mean standardized K-index from 13 geomagnetic observatories between 44 degrees and 60 degrees northern or southern geomagnetic latitude. The Estimated 3-hour Planetary Kp-index is a preliminary Kp-index derived at the NOAA Space Weather Prediction Center using minute by minute data from a number of ground-based magnetometers that relay data in near-real time. The official Kp index is derived by calculating a weighted average of K-indices from a predetermined network of geomagnetic observatories, the official Kp network. The K-index quantifies disturbances in the horizontal component of earth's magnetic field with an integer in the range 0-9 with 1 being calm and 5 or more indicating a geomagnetic storm. Furnace Creek Ranch in Death Valley, California holds this crown and achieved this global high on July 10, 1913. http://www.theusner.eu/terra/aurora/kp_archive.php?year=2023&month=03&day=01&ndays=3. The K-index itself is a three hour long quasi-logarithmic local index of the geomagnetic activity at the given location and time compared to a calm day curve.
